Curves on a surface which minimize length between the endpoints are called geodesics; they are the shape that an elastic band stretched between the two points would take. Mathematically they are described using ordinary differential equations and the calculus of variations. WebAug 2, 2024 · The Deform Curves on Surface node is used to attach the new hair curves of Blender 3.3 to a surface, e.g. the head or body. It is needed when the surface is deformed by a modifier such as the Armature, Wave, or the Subdivision Surface modifier.
